#5e1e52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e1e52 is composed of 36.9% red, 11.8%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.1% magenta, 12.8%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 311.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.6% and a lightness of 24.3%. #5e1e52 color hex could be obtained by blending #bc3ca4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#5e1e52 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e1e52 has RGB values of R:94, G:30,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.13,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 6168146.
